Vitaliy, could you please describe how you wired the AFP 989? What wires connect to the power supply and what wires connect to the GEM. The data sheet is confusing and shows only 2 wires. Is that a resister in the diagram too? If so what is the value?

Re: Pulse Output for water meter

Posted: Thu Nov 22, 2012 11:41 am
by vitaliy_kh
Hi,

Sensor itself has four wires interface.
Pulse counter input needs only two wires.
Here is a link to the sensor’s spec:
http://www.emxinc.com/pdf/photoelectric ... FP989S.pdf
Blue Wire is a Common GND.
This wire should be connected to the Pulse Input Common (GND) and to the Negative (GND)
of the Power Supply for the sensor. Power Supply for the sensor could be any type of DC
voltage source with output voltage from 10V up to 30V (12V DC Regulated Power Convertor
is preferable but not required.) Positive wire from Power Supply should be connected to the
Brown Wire of the sensor. (Brown Wire is a power supply for the sensor).
White Wire is a Sensor Output Polarity configuration option. For this application it does not
really matter what polarity is. So connect White Wire to the Common (GND).
Black Wire is a Sensor Output. This wire should be connected to the Pulse Counter input.
Depend on which sensor version you are using (NPN or PNP) and what exactly GEM input
is configured you may need external Pull-up or Pull-down resistor.
I am using ECM-1240 (not a GEM). Pulse input already has a Pull-up resistor.
So, in my case I don’t need external resistor at all. But only NPN Sensor version is directly
compatible with ECM-1240 Pulse Input.
If GEM Pulse Input has an Input OptoCoupler the wiring story will be a bit different but
actually more flexible.

Hi,

Well,
- “yes” if GEM Pulse Counter Input is a low impedance logic
(i.e. opto-coupler or it already has a pull-up or pull down resistor);
- “no” if input is a high impedance (i.e. CMOS Gate, Comparator, etc.)

Depend on exact Input Implementation (this info may be highlighted
in GEM documentation or Ben or Paul should address this question in
a better details) you still may need external resistor.

For instance, ECM-1240 input is a Comparator with built-in pull-up
resistor. In this case NPN sensor is directly compatible with ECM-1240 input.
PNP Sensor still could be used but will require few external components.

Vitaliy, for the sake of knowledge Here is the descriptions for the Pulse Counters on page 22 of the GEM manual:

The GEM has four pulse count inputs.

Pulse counter #1 and #2 are totally isolated from the GEM ground and circuit. Either of these two inputs require a DC pulse signal between 3V and 24VDC.

Pulse counters #3 and #4 are “dry” contact type counters. These inputs require switch contacts not connected to any power source, such as relay contacts or magnet switch contacts. Very low voltage from the circuit (5VDC) is used to complete the circuit.
